第一部分:了解编程
编程是什么?
编程,简单来说,就是用计算机能够理解的语言编写指令,让计算机完成特定任务的过程。这个过程就像是我们给计算机写了一本操作手册,告诉它如何执行各种复杂的操作。
编程的重要性
在当今这个数字化时代,编程已经成为一种基本技能。无论是从事软件开发、数据分析、人工智能等领域,还是仅仅为了日常生活中的便捷,编程都能为你带来巨大的帮助。
第二部分:编程语言简介
常见的编程语言
- Python:简单易学,广泛应用于数据分析、人工智能、网站开发等领域。
- Java:跨平台性强,广泛应用于企业级应用开发。
- C/C++:性能优越,广泛应用于操作系统、游戏开发等领域。
- JavaScript:网页开发的主要语言,负责网页的动态效果。
选择合适的编程语言
选择编程语言时,应考虑自己的兴趣、需求以及未来发展方向。例如,如果你对数据分析感兴趣,可以选择Python;如果你对游戏开发感兴趣,可以选择C/C++。
第三部分:编程环境搭建
操作系统
- Windows:适合初学者,编程软件丰富。
- macOS:适合Mac用户,性能优越。
- Linux:开源免费,安全性高。
编程软件
- Visual Studio Code:功能强大,支持多种编程语言。
- PyCharm:Python开发专用,功能完善。
- Eclipse:Java开发专用,历史悠久。
环境搭建步骤
- 选择合适的操作系统和编程软件。
- 下载并安装操作系统和编程软件。
- 配置编程环境(如Python的pip、Java的JDK等)。
第四部分:编程基础
变量和数据类型
- 变量:用于存储数据的容器。
- 数据类型:变量可以存储的数据类型,如整数、浮点数、字符串等。
控制结构
- 顺序结构:按照代码编写的顺序执行。
- 选择结构:根据条件判断执行不同的代码块。
- 循环结构:重复执行某段代码。
函数
- 函数:用于封装一段可重复使用的代码。
第五部分:实战练习
编写第一个程序
- 打开编程软件,创建一个新的文件。
- 输入以下代码:
print("Hello, World!")
- 运行程序,观察输出结果。
练习项目
- 计算器:实现加减乘除运算。
- 猜数字游戏:编写一个简单的猜数字游戏。
- 网页制作:使用HTML和CSS制作一个简单的网页。
第六部分:进阶学习
数据结构和算法
- 数据结构:用于存储和组织数据的方式。
- 算法:解决问题的步骤和方法。
版本控制
- Git:用于版本控制,方便代码管理和协作。
编程规范
- 代码规范:编写代码时应遵循的规范,如命名规范、缩进规范等。
第七部分:总结
通过以上学习,相信你已经对编程有了初步的了解。编程是一个充满挑战和乐趣的过程,希望你能坚持学习,不断提升自己的编程能力。
